Types of Fall Protection Devices
A variety of devices provide critical life-saving protection:
Cages: These semi-enclosures have historically appeared on fixed ladders to act as a barrier to slow descent during a fall. Despite their use, cages offer limited protection compared to advanced devices, leading to updates in safety standards.
Ladder Lifeline Systems: A more modern approach involves lifeline systems with a cable or track secured directly to the ladder. Workers use a chest or full-body harness attached to the system, allowing mobility. These systems engage instantaneously if a climber begins to fall, providing quick arrest of the descent.
Fall Arrest Systems: These comprehensive setups feature combinations of harnesses, lanyards, and anchorage points designed to stop falls rapidly. Workers must receive extensive training in the correct use and maintenance of fall arrest equipment. The Centers for Disease Control and Prevention emphasizes the significance of familiarity with these systems for safety assurance. Regular inspection and timely replacement of components maintain optimal device readiness.

OSHA Regulations for Fixed Ladder Safety
Fixed ladders play an indispensable role across numerous sectors, necessitating adherence to rigorous standards for safeguarding users. The Occupational Safety and Health Administration (OSHA) introduces extensive guidelines aimed at mitigating fall-related hazards on fixed ladders. This discussion delves into OSHA's ladder safety provisions and the essential equipment mandated for regulatory compliance.
OSHA Requirements for Fall Protection
Per OSHA's revised regulations, any fixed ladder extending beyond 24 feet must feature fall protection mechanisms. Implemented since November 19, 2018, these updates stipulate the incorporation of advanced ladder safety systems or personal fall arrest systems for such ladders. These measures must be operational on all fixed ladders by November 18, 2036, discontinuing reliance on cages or wells as solitary solutions.
According to OSHA 1910.28(b)(9), new and replacement ladders require assembled ladder safety systems to achieve compliance. Common components include lifelines, connectors, safety sleeves, and body harnesses. Personal fall arrest systems—encompassing full-body harnesses, single lanyards, or retractable lifelines—act as pivotal tools for shielding personnel from fall threats.
Essential Safety Equipment
Optimal fall protection mandates utilizing appropriate safety gear. Ladder safety systems generally comprise a cage, well, or safety device. Cages or wells serve as enclosures shielding ladder ascent paths, thereby reducing fall risks. Ladder devices incorporate self-retracting lifelines or sliding arrestors for regulated ascent and descent.
Personal fall arrest systems represent another cornerstone of protective equipment designed to halt falls while lessening arresting forces. These systems comprise an anchor point, connector, full-body harness, and optional deceleration devices such as energy absorbers or lanyards. Ongoing inspections and maintenance remain critical, ensuring functionality, while identifying potential wear or damage. Effective fall protection strategies hinge on these thorough assessments.

Importance of Regular Maintenance
Consistent maintenance ensures fall arrest systems function as intended. It's vital to perform regular inspections on all system components, searching for wear, corrosion, or damage. Maintenance routines should include scrutinizing harness stitching for frays, checking ladders' structural integrity, and verifying the condition of connectors and hooks. These actions adhere to OSHA recommendations, fortifying workplace safety and mitigating accident risks.
